One of the best ways of ensuring your electrical system is in good condition is to have an electrical installation condition report carried out periodically. An electrical inspection is recommended every ten years in private domestic homes. A report will detail any defects in your homes wiring along with any serious dangers and recommendations for safety improvements. The report itself can be written in less than an hour but the testing and inspection process required in order to obtain the information for the report can take several hours. Be wary of an EICR that was produced very quickly as it is likely that little testing or inspection was carried out.
Back to topElectrical Testing, also known as fixed wire testing, is the process that is carried out before an EICR is produced. During the testing and inspection process, a full visual check of all electrical accessories (like sockets and switches) will be carried out to ensure that there are no immediate dangers from damaged equipment. The testing process involved checking the earthing, safety connections to pipework, trip switch functionality, electric shock protection measures and much more. Various tests are carried out by the electrician to ensure that the electrical system is functioning correctly and will turn off the electrical supply if there is a fault. Back to topThe fuse board is the most important component of the modern electrical system. Without a fuse board or consumer unit, all our cables around our home would have to be gigantic, there would be little electrical shock protection and one fault in our wiring would mean that the whole house would lose its lights, sockets and everything else electric. A modern consumer unit fulfils the electrical needs of the modern home. The consumer unit offers, overload and fault protection, electric shock protection, equipment and cable protection from surges and helps to divide the electrical system into smaller electrical 'circuits'. It is important that this box is kept up to date as it can make the difference between receiving a fatal electrical shock or not.
